Black spruce (Picea mariana) , seeds from Marie-Victorin

Black spruce (Picea mariana) is an emblematic tree of Quebec's boreal forests, known for its great robustness and slender shape. Adapted to poor and humid soils, this conifer is a perfect choice for reforestation projects, windbreaks or rustic developments. In addition to its ecological role, black spruce is associated with the traditional production of spruce beer, a nod to its cultural heritage.

Spread : 1 to 3 meters
Plant height : 10 to 15 meters (at maturity)
Quantity per pack : 100 seeds
Companion plants : white birch, alder, jack pine
Enemy plants : none known
Hardiness zone : 2
Exposure : sun, partial shade
Moisture : Fresh, moist, well-drained soil

Sowing Instructions : No pre-treatment is required. Sow directly in desired location as soon as temperatures become mild, or in fall for natural germination the following spring or later. Ensure soil is well-drained, but can remain cool or moist.
